BARNSTABLE – The Cape Cod Chamber of Commerce’s new co-working space will have a mural – now all they need is someone to paint it.

The space is located at the chamber’s administrative offices at 5 Patti Page Way in Centerville and is designed to give local entrepreneurs and businesspeople a place to surround themselves with others who want to help businesses grow.

Artists interested in taking on the project can tour the facility on October 12th from 9 to 10 a.m.

The deadline for designs is October 14th, and the mural must be completed by December 15th.

Compensation totaling $3,500 will be given to the chosen artist who completes the project.
